''The 2026 Hyundai IONIQ 9 is an excellent pick for an electric three-row SUV. We like its refined interior, smooth ride quality and quick acceleration,'' Edmunds writes.
''We're accustomed to Hyundais offering many features and strong overall value, but the IONIQ 9 breaks new ground in comfort, cargo and range. We like that the biggest IONIQ offers the key benefits of SUV ownership -- great visibility and a commanding seating position -- while being low enough to make getting in and out and cargo loading easy. Coupled with comfy seats and a plush ride that doesn't overly compromise its drivability, the IONIQ 9 strikes a delicate balance. What's more, both of our test vehicles exceeded their EPA-estimated range and charged at a rate that rivals the best EVs. and though it has a higher-capacity battery than its brother, the Kia EV9, it also offers more cargo space -- a packaging enigma that we love. This is a cutting-edge eclectic SUV in almost every way.''

Northwest Automotive Press Association (NWAPA) Drive Revolution: Vehicle of the Year and Best Battery Electric Vehicle. Red Dot Design Award: A 2025 award for design. Wards 10 Best Engines & Propulsion Systems: Named one of the top systems in 2025 for innovation and performance. Midwest Automotive Media Association (MAMA): Favorite Plug-in Vehicle, tying with the Volvo EX90.
These accolades highlight the IONIQ 9's strengths in areas like its three-row layout, versatile passenger and cargo space, and its performance and innovative design, according to the award sources.
The projected EPA range estimate for the S RWD model with 19-inch wheels is 335 miles, according to Hyundai. The SE and SEL all-wheel drive models deliver 320 miles of range, while the Performance AWD models check in with 311 miles per charge. The automaker claims the 110.3-kWh lithium-ion battery can be recharged from 10 to 80 percent in just 24 minutes on a properly operating 350-kW DC fast charger.
